Conditions

Early Alzheimer’s Disease

Brief summary

1. Primary efficacy endpoint: Change in the Clinical Dementia Rating -Sum of Boxes (CDR-SB) from baseline to Week 52.

Detailed description

1. Efficacy Endpoints • Change in the Integrated Alzheimer’s Disease Rating Scale (iADRS) from baseline to Week 52. • Change in selected blood biomarkers (p-Tau217, amyloid β-protein Aβ40, and Aβ42) from baseline to Week 52., 2. Safety Endpoints: The safety endpoints of this study are as follows: • spontaneously reported adverse events (AEs) • clinical laboratory tests • vital sign and body weight measurements • physical and neurological examinations • Columbia Suicide Severity Rating Scale (C-SSRS), 3. Exploratory endpoints: • Change in blood biomarkers (neurofilament light chain and glial fibrillary acidic protein) from baseline to Week 52 • Change of brain volume in volumetric magnetic resonance imaging (vMRI) measures at baseline and Week 52 • Plasma PK of TML-6 treatment after first dose • Change in brain amyloid pathophysiology from baseline to Week 52 as measured by amyloid positron emission tomography (PET) scans at selected study sites
